How to Select the Correct Voltage (36V vs. 48V) for Your Application?
36V systems suit light-duty tricycles (1-2kW motors), while 48V batteries power 3-5kW golf carts efficiently. A 48V 150Ah LiFePO4 battery delivers 7.2kWh energy – 30% more runtime than 36V 200Ah models. Match voltage to controller ratings: 48V systems reduce current draw by 25%, minimizing heat in 5000W setups.

For solar-powered applications, 48V systems demonstrate superior efficiency with 92% energy retention versus 36V’s 85% in multi-day cycling tests. The higher voltage allows thinner gauge wiring – 48V setups can use 6AWG cables instead of 36V’s 4AWG requirements for equivalent power transmission. When upgrading existing systems, verify motor controllers support lithium chemistry charging profiles to prevent compatibility issues.

Can Bluetooth Monitoring Extend Battery Lifespan?
Integrated Bluetooth 5.0 enables 0.1V voltage precision monitoring via smartphone apps. Users track cell balancing, set charge thresholds (e.g., 90% for storage), and receive imbalance alerts. Data logging (500+ cycles) helps optimize charging patterns – a 2023 study showed 23% lifespan increase with active Bluetooth management versus passive use.

Advanced systems provide granular diagnostics including individual cell temperatures (±1°C accuracy) and internal resistance measurements. Users can program automated maintenance cycles – for example, initiating balance charging when cell variance exceeds 50mV. Fleet operators benefit from cloud-connected systems that aggregate data from multiple batteries, identifying underperforming units before they affect operations. Real-world data shows batteries with active Bluetooth management achieve 98% of their theoretical cycle life versus 82% for unmonitored units.
What Makes a Battery Truly Waterproof?
IP67-rated LiFePO4 batteries withstand 1m submersion for 30 minutes. Critical features include laser-welded stainless steel casings, dual-layer O-ring seals, and nano-coated circuit boards. Testing involves 200-hour salt spray exposure and 500 thermal cycles (-20°C to 60°C). Genuine waterproofing prevents dendrite growth in humid conditions, a common failure point in cheaper “splash-resistant” models.
Are These Batteries Compatible With Solar Charging Systems?
LiFePO4’s 14.4-58.4V charging range integrates seamlessly with MPPT controllers. A 48V 150Ah battery fully recharges via 1500W solar array in 5.8 sun hours. Built-in BMS prevents overvoltage (above 3.65V/cell) and enables 0.5C fast charging – 0-100% in 2 hours using 75A commercial chargers.
FAQ
- How long do 200Ah LiFePO4 batteries last in golf carts?
- Properly maintained 48V 200Ah batteries provide 70-100km range per charge in 5000W carts, lasting 8-12 years with 80% capacity retention after 2000 cycles.
- Can I connect multiple Bluetooth batteries in series?
- Yes, premium BMS systems sync up to 16 batteries (768V max) via mesh networking. Ensure all units are within 2% capacity variance before linking.
- What maintenance do waterproof batteries require?
- Annual terminal cleaning (torque to 8-12Nm), firmware updates via Bluetooth, and visual inspection for casing dents. No electrolyte checks needed – fully sealed design.
